Itau (ITUB) stock analysis | technical resistance patterns, analyst upgrades, revenue growth. Itaú Unibanco Banco Holding SA (ITUB) closed at $7.86, up 0.54% on the session. The stock continues to trade above its support level of $7.47 while resistance at $8.25 remains a critical barrier. This modest gain reflects cautious optimism in the Brazilian banking sector.
